01 v. t. To dry by a fire.
imp. & p. p.
Torrefied; p. pr. & vb. n.
Torrefying
-
1.
To dry by a fire.
-
2.
To subject to scorching heat, so as to drive off volatile ingredients; to roast, as ores.(Metal.)
-
3.
To dry or parch, as drugs, on a metallic plate till they are friable, or are reduced to the state desired.(Pharm.)
